About Zubaida Yousaf

Zubaida Yousaf is a scholar working on Pharmacology, Complementary and alternative medicine and Plant Science, having authored 63 papers that have together received 1.4k indexed citations. Recurring topics across this work include Essential Oils and Antimicrobial Activity (9 papers), Phytochemicals and Antioxidant Activities (5 papers), Plant tissue culture and regeneration (5 papers), Natural product bioactivities and synthesis (4 papers), Bee Products Chemical Analysis (4 papers), Ethnobotanical and Medicinal Plants Studies (4 papers), Nigella sativa pharmacological applications (4 papers) and Medicinal Plant Pharmacodynamics Research (4 papers). The work is most often cited by research in Pharmacology (315 citations), Complementary and alternative medicine (246 citations) and Food Science (482 citations). Zubaida Yousaf has collaborated with scholars based in Pakistan, China and Saudi Arabia. Frequent co-authors include Javad Sharifi‐Rad, Mehdi Sharifi‐Rad, Bahare Salehi, Marcello Iriti, Elena Maria Varoni, Majid Sharifi‐Rad, Dima Mnayer, Maria Flaviana Bezerra Morais‐Braga, Henrique Douglas Melo Coutinho and Farzad Kobarfard. Their work appears in journ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Molecules.
